深入理解jQuery最新版

jquery最新版 jquery最新版本是多少

jQuery,一个轻量级、快速的JavaScript库,已经成为了web开发中不可或缺的工具,它简化了HTML文档遍历、事件处理、动画和Ajax交互等常见的Web编程任务,本文将深入探讨jQuery的最新版本,并详细解析其新特性和使用方法。

我们需要了解什么是jQuery,简单来说,jQuery是一个JavaScript库,它极大地简化了JavaScript编程,通过使用jQuery,我们可以快速地完成DOM操作、事件处理、动画效果、Ajax请求等任务,jQuery的主要优点是它的语法简洁明了,易于学习和使用,jQuery还提供了丰富的插件,可以方便地扩展其功能。

接下来,我们来看看jQuery的最新版本,在最新的版本中,jQuery引入了一些新的功能和改进,使得开发者可以更加高效地进行Web开发。

1、选择器引擎的改进:jQuery的选择器引擎是其最强大的功能之一,在最新版本中,jQuery对选择器引擎进行了优化,提高了选择器的性能,新版本的jQuery支持更多的CSS选择器,包括属性选择器、子元素选择器等,jQuery还引入了一种新的选择器类型——"基本选择器",它可以用于选择任何类型的元素,包括文本节点、注释节点等。

2、DOM操作的改进:在最新版本的jQuery中,DOM操作的性能得到了显著提升,新版本的jQuery提供了一个新的方法——"wrapAll",它可以将所有匹配的元素包裹在一个指定的元素中,jQuery还引入了一种新的方法——"detach",它可以将匹配的元素从DOM树中移除,但不删除这些元素的数据。

3、事件处理的改进:在最新版本的jQuery中,事件处理的功能也得到了增强,新版本的jQuery提供了一个新的方法——"on",它可以用于绑定事件处理器到指定的元素上,jQuery还引入了一种新的事件类型——"hover",它可以用于处理鼠标悬停事件。

4、动画效果的改进:在最新版本的jQuery中,动画效果的性能和功能都得到了提升,新版本的jQuery提供了一个新的方法——"animate",它可以用于创建复杂的动画效果,jQuery还引入了一种新的动画类型——"step",它可以用于创建步骤式的动画效果。

5、Ajax请求的改进:在最新版本的jQuery中,Ajax请求的功能也得到了增强,新版本的jQuery提供了一个新的方法——"getJSON",它可以用于发送GET请求并接收JSON数据,jQuery还引入了一种新的Ajax选项——"processData",它可以用于控制是否对发送的数据进行预处理。

jQuery的最新版本提供了许多新的功能和改进,使得开发者可以更加高效地进行Web开发,无论使用哪个版本的jQuery,都需要理解其核心概念和基本用法,只有这样,我们才能充分利用jQuery的强大功能,编写出高效、稳定的Web应用。